数据库异构表是什么

不及物动词 其他 38

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库异构表是指在一个数据库中,存储了不同类型、结构或格式的数据的表。异构表的设计可以使得数据库能够存储多种不同的数据,并且可以通过查询和操作这些数据。

    下面是关于数据库异构表的五个要点:

    1. 存储不同类型的数据:异构表可以存储不同类型的数据,例如文本、数值、日期、图像、音频等。这使得数据库能够处理多种不同的数据类型,并且可以根据需要进行查询和分析。

    2. 不同结构的数据:异构表可以存储具有不同结构的数据。例如,一个表可以包含多个列,每个列可以具有不同的数据类型和长度。这种设计使得数据库能够灵活地存储和处理不同结构的数据。

    3. 不同格式的数据:异构表可以存储具有不同格式的数据。例如,一个表可以存储结构化数据、半结构化数据和非结构化数据。这使得数据库能够处理各种不同格式的数据,并且可以根据需要进行查询和分析。

    4. 数据转换和集成:异构表可以通过数据转换和集成来处理不同类型、结构和格式的数据。例如,可以使用ETL(抽取、转换和加载)工具将数据从一个表转移到另一个表,以便进行进一步的分析和处理。

    5. 数据一致性和完整性:异构表设计需要考虑数据一致性和完整性的问题。在存储和处理不同类型、结构和格式的数据时,需要确保数据的一致性和完整性。这可以通过定义适当的约束和规则来实现,以确保数据的正确性和可靠性。

    总结来说,数据库异构表是一种能够存储不同类型、结构和格式的数据的表。它们允许数据库存储和处理多种不同的数据,并且可以通过数据转换和集成来实现数据一致性和完整性。异构表的设计可以使得数据库更加灵活和强大,能够满足不同类型数据的存储和处理需求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库异构表指的是在一个数据库中,存在不同结构、不同类型的表。一般而言,数据库中的表都是由相同的结构和类型组成的,例如关系型数据库中的表都是由行和列组成的二维表。而异构表则是指在同一个数据库中,存在不同结构和类型的表。

    在实际应用中,数据库异构表主要有以下几种情况:

    1. 不同类型的数据库表:在一个数据库中,可以同时存在关系型数据库表、文档型数据库表、图数据库表等不同类型的表。这种情况下,不同类型的表具有不同的数据结构和查询方式,可以根据需要选择合适的数据库类型来存储和查询数据。

    2. 不同结构的数据库表:在一个数据库中,可以存在不同结构的表,例如关系型数据库中的表和键值对数据库中的表。这种情况下,不同结构的表具有不同的字段和关系,需要根据具体需求来选择使用哪种表结构。

    3. 不同数据源的数据库表:在一个数据库中,可以同时存储来自不同数据源的表,例如从不同的数据库、文件或者外部系统中导入的数据。这种情况下,不同数据源的表可能具有不同的数据类型和数据格式,需要进行数据转换和整合。

    数据库异构表的存在可以提供更灵活的数据管理和查询方式。通过在同一个数据库中存储不同结构、不同类型的表,可以方便地进行数据整合和查询。同时,数据库异构表也带来了一些挑战,例如数据转换和一致性维护等问题需要进行处理。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库异构表是指在一个数据库中存在多个不同结构的表。通常情况下,一个数据库中的表具有相同的结构,即具有相同的列和数据类型。而异构表则允许在同一个数据库中创建具有不同结构的表。

    数据库异构表可以提供更灵活的数据存储方式,可以存储不同类型的数据,方便数据的管理和查询。常见的数据库异构表包括关系型表和非关系型表的混合使用,例如在一个数据库中同时存在关系型表和文档型表。

    在使用数据库异构表时,需要根据具体的需求进行设计和操作。下面将从方法和操作流程两个方面来讲解数据库异构表的使用。

    一、方法

    1. 数据库选择:选择一个支持异构表的数据库管理系统,例如Oracle、MySQL、SQL Server等。

    2. 表设计:根据需求设计异构表的结构,包括表名、列名、数据类型等。根据数据的特点选择适合的存储方式,例如关系型表、文档型表、键值对表等。

    3. 数据插入:根据表的结构,插入相应的数据。可以使用SQL语句进行插入操作,也可以通过图形化界面进行操作。

    4. 数据查询:根据需要进行数据查询,可以使用SQL语句进行查询操作,也可以通过图形化界面进行操作。根据不同的表结构,选择合适的查询语句。

    5. 数据更新:根据需要更新数据,可以使用SQL语句进行更新操作,也可以通过图形化界面进行操作。根据不同的表结构,选择合适的更新语句。

    6. 数据删除:根据需要删除数据,可以使用SQL语句进行删除操作,也可以通过图形化界面进行操作。根据不同的表结构,选择合适的删除语句。

    二、操作流程

    1. 创建数据库:在数据库管理系统中创建一个新的数据库。

    2. 创建异构表:在创建数据库后,根据需求创建异构表。可以通过SQL语句或图形化界面进行创建操作。根据表的结构,选择合适的创建语句。

    3. 插入数据:在创建表后,根据表的结构,插入相应的数据。可以使用SQL语句或图形化界面进行插入操作。

    4. 查询数据:根据需要进行数据查询,可以使用SQL语句或图形化界面进行查询操作。

    5. 更新数据:根据需要更新数据,可以使用SQL语句或图形化界面进行更新操作。

    6. 删除数据:根据需要删除数据,可以使用SQL语句或图形化界面进行删除操作。

    7. 维护和管理:定期对数据库进行维护和管理,包括备份、恢复、优化等操作。

    总结:
    数据库异构表是在一个数据库中存在多个不同结构的表。使用数据库异构表可以提供更灵活的数据存储方式,方便数据的管理和查询。在使用数据库异构表时,需要根据具体的需求进行设计和操作,包括数据库选择、表设计、数据插入、数据查询、数据更新和数据删除等。通过合理的方法和操作流程,可以有效地使用数据库异构表。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部